She's Too Busy Winning to Watch Him Cry novel Chapter 182

The comment section was flooded with remarks like: [Our darling girl's skin is amazing.]

[A kind of lazy, fragile beauty.]

[Wanna kiss her.]

Lyra's eyes darkened. Did she really have to resort to such extreme tactics to gain followers? Furious, she immediately deleted the photo.

She wanted to hunt Caleb down, but he was nowhere to be found.

Thinking about how he and Kayla still hadn't made up, Lyra felt an ache in her chest. Kayla had been visibly depressed the past few days, and it was hard to watch.

Taking matters into her own hands, Lyra secretly ordered a bouquet of red roses under Caleb's name, hoping to cheer her up.

But despite all her careful planning, she miscalculated one crucial detail.

Kayla wasn't home. She had already packed up and gone back to the Harrington estate.

That carefully prepared bouquet never made it to her hands.

The next day, Caleb was MIA all day.

Since he was supposed to attend a luncheon, Lyra had to go in his place.

Fortunately, Madeline was going too, so they could keep each other company.

When Lyra and Madeline arrived, they immediately spotted Jasmine standing next to Rowan, talking softly. They were paused in front of a famous painting, and Jasmine seemed to be sharing her insights.

Rowan leaned in with impeccable manners, listening attentively with a warm, gentle smile playing on his lips.

It was a stark contrast to his usual cold demeanor.

When he smiled, he looked calm and refined, his presence exuding a quiet confidence. He wasn't flashy, but he commanded the room naturally, making it impossible to look away.

Lucas was also there today. As soon as he spotted Lyra walking in, a malicious smirk curled on his lips. He slowly pulled out his phone and turned the screen toward her.

It was the candid photo of her sleeping in the office, but he had maliciously edited it. A round pig snout, obnoxiously bright blush, and a pair of floppy cartoon pig ears were pasted over her face.

Lyra knew nothing good was going to happen the moment he approached. Seeing his screen, her face darkened. She pretended to walk away before suddenly snatching the phone right out of his hand.

She immediately changed his lock screen, deleted the photo from his camera roll, and cleared his recently deleted folder. She dodged Lucas while doing it, and Madeline jumped in to block him. The ensuing scuffle caused quite a commotion.

Rowan merely glanced in the direction of the noise before withdrawing his gaze.
